whakatūtū - erect
whakatutu. 1. v.t. Fasten a net to a hoop for the purpose of catching certain kinds of fish. page 463
2. Hold open a basket, etc. Whakatutua te kete.
3. n. A pattern in weaving mats, kete, and girdles.
Williams Dictionary
whakatutu, v.t. Place anything so that water may play on it. Whakatutua te karaha (Place the bowl so that water may run into it).
Ko ngā tāngata o Pōneke, ka whakatūtū i ō rātou whare ki ngā tahataha o ngā puke.in Wellington, people build houses on the sides of hills.
